Mabini : a pleasant hotel, with excellent cooking. The cook made our pizza from fresh dough. In a quiet neighbourhood, with large rooms, just far enough from Mambajao centre to escape the traffic, close enough to shops, eateries and banks. Mabini Lodge has plenty of parking for our rented scooter. I enjoyed the modest swimming pool, plus the relaxing bar and restaurant area. Probably the best hotel of our 2 month Philippines holiday. We paid roughly £25 per night, stayed 4 nights in March 2024.

When you stay at Hotel Bijoux in Plaridel, you'll be 21 mi (33.9 km) from Sibucal Hot Spring.
Pamper yourself with onsite massages or make use of the other amenities, which include complimentary wireless internet access.
Enjoy a meal at the restaurant or snacks in the hotel's coffee shop/cafe. Relax with your favorite drink at the bar/lounge or the beach bar. Cooked-to-order breakfasts are available daily from 6:00 AM to 10:30 AM for a fee.
Featured amenities include a business center, laundry facilities, and coffee/tea in a common area. Self parking (subject to charges) is available onsite.
Make yourself at home in one of the 7 guestrooms. Complimentary wireless internet access is available to keep you connected. Bathrooms have showers and hair dryers. Conveniences include electric kettles and free tea bags/instant coffee, and housekeeping is provided daily.

It's about 7️⃣ to 🔟minutes by TukTuk from the airport. It's located a little to the north and west. The resort's own garden can directly see the white island. The garden is also very beautiful. I stayed at this resort for four nights and five days, one night. It is a room facing the seaside garden where you can directly see the coral white sand island. It is very enjoyable. There is a huge toilet, sofa, kitchen, refrigerator, etc. The room has air conditioning, TV, ceiling fan, toilet, ventilation fan, etc. Toiletries can also be provided upon request. The boss is a Westerner, who looks like someone from France and Italy. The wife of the boss is a local and seems to be a very capable woman. The overall service is very good, but because of the island relationship, power outages and network instability are very common things, as island players know (luxury hotels like Madai are not included in the comparison). If there is no internet in the evening, go and chat with the waiter at the English corner. There is a tall waitress with a nice smile. She is lively and fun. She is a fan of domestic idol dramas. She is shy when talking about Chinese male stars. Face. The recommended dinner of chicken and mushroom pasta was the best thing I had in that time (see picture). They are also very active in planning and helping to order TukTuk or multicab. We even got to know each other later and even helped me inquire about the price of the Cebu city tour after I left the hotel, which was very considerate. The hotel guests are mainly Westerners and middle-class local guests. There is also a motorcycle rental service (it is recommended that you know how to drive a motorcycle and have a domestic driver's license. For others, it is recommended to rent a driver because there are many mountain roads and it is not safe).

Ultra Winds Mountain Resort is a perfect place to stay if you need to unwind from a busy work. It has a good view of nature with infinity pools. The rooms are spacious and great too. I think the only downside is the location since you’d need a private vehicle or hire one just to get there.
